用偏最小二乘法的计算光度法同时测定原油和渣油中的铁、镍、钒

SIMULTANEOUS DETERMINATION OF IRON, NICKEL AND VANADIUM IN CRUDE OIL AND RESIDUAL OIL WITH PLS-COMPUTATIVE SPECTROPHOTOMETRY

【摘要】 用偏最小二乘法(PLS)的计算光度法同时测定了原油和渣油中的微量铁、镍、钒,对测定波长选择问题和抽象组分数的确定方法进行了研究。对模拟石油中铁、镍、钒含量制成的合成样进行了回收实验。结果表明,在铁、镍、钒加入量为0.4~10μg/25mL时,其回收率为94%~103%,优于用多元线性回归法的测定结果。

【Abstract】 A method for simultaneous determination of iron, nickel and vanadium in crude oil and residual oil with PLS (partial least squares)-computative spectrophotometry is described.The selection of wavelength and method for determining the component number are studied.The experimental results show that the recovery is 94%  ̄ 103% when the added contents of iron,nickel and vanadium are in the range of 0. 4 ̄ 10 μg/25 mL. The result determined using PLS method is better than that of multiple linear regression (MLR) method.
